Jaume Miquel

Jaume Miquel

Chairman & Chief Executive Officer, Tendam

Jaume Miquel is Chairman and CEO of Tendam, one of the top names in the European fashion sector, specialising in brand management in the premium mass market segments, which currently has ten own brands: Women’secret, Springfield, Cortefiel, Pedro del Hierro, Hoss Intropia, Slowlove, High Spirits, Dash and Stars, OOTO and Fifty.

Jaume boasts extensive experience in the textile sector. He was Managing Director of Women'secret for ten years, combining this role with his responsibilities as Managing Director for Cortefiel and Pedro del Hierro. He previously served as Head of Southern Europe and Member of the European Steering Committee at Timberland and European Communication Director for Dockers – Levi Strauss.

He was a professor on the Master’s in International Retail and the International MBA Exchange Programme at the University of Pompeu Fabra for two years, and was an assistant professor of Commercial Strategy at Ramón Llull University in 1995.

Readers of Modaes voted Miquel “Personality of the Year” in 2017 in recognition of his outstanding performance in steering the company in a new direction.

In December 2019, Forbes Magazine named him “Man of the Day” following the incorporation of the Hoss/Intropia brand into the Tendam portfolio.

Jaume holds a Degree in Economics from the University of Barcelona and completed an Executive Training Programme in Business Administration through the IESE Business School.

About Tendam

Tendam is one of the top names in the European fashion sector, specialising in brand management in the premium mass market segment. It is an open, omnichannel ecosystem able to optimise the traffic of more than 350 million digital and brick-and-mortar consumers. The company currently has ten brands: Women’secret, Springfield, Cortefiel, Pedro del Hierro, Hoss Intropia, Slowlove, High Spirits, Dash and Stars, OOTO and Fifty. It also sells third party brands through its new multi-brand omnichannel platform. It operates in almost 80 countries across four continents and has more than 1,800 points of sale, including directly operated stores, e-commerce and franchises.
